Maintaining a balance among stock levels is vital to driving sales and maximizing profits. A well-managed inventory system ensures that popular products are always available to meet customer demand, minimizing lost sales due to outages. Conversely, avoiding overstocking minimizes the risk of spoilage and frees up valuable capital for expansion. Implementing a robust inventory management system, inclusive demand forecasting, reorder points, and regular stock audits can significantly enhance your ability to meet customer needs and drive sales growth. To achieve optimal results, consider leveraging technology solutions such as inventory management software to streamline processes and gain valuable insights into your stock performance.

Fine-tuning Item Pricing Strategies

Successfully launching an effective item pricing strategy is vital for boosting profitability and driving sales. By carefully analyzing market conditions, opposing prices, and customer habits, businesses can determine optimal pricing points that achieve value perception with revenue generation.

A in-depth pricing strategy often entails techniques like cost-plus pricing, value-based pricing, and market pricing. Regularly evaluating the effectiveness of pricing decisions is crucial for adjusting strategies in response to fluctuating market conditions and customer needs.

Inventory Control: A Key to Success

Effective inventory management is absolutely fundamental for the flourishing of any business. By implementing robust inventory control procedures, organizations can mitigate the risks associated with overstocking, minimize spoilage and ensure seamless operations.

A well-structured inventory system allows for real-time visibility of inventory levels, enabling businesses to make informed decisions regarding purchasing, production, and delivery. This leads to effective capital management, resulting in substantial cost savings and improved financial performance.
